在现代软件开发中,GitHub已成为一个重要的代码托管平台。很多开发者和团队都利用GitHub来管理项目代码、协作开发和版本控制。而将GitHub上的项目复制到本地是开发者进行本地开发的重要一步。本文将为您详细讲解如何将GitHub项目复制到本地的各个步骤及相关注意事项。
1. 准备工作
在开始复制项目之前,确保您已经完成以下准备工作:
- 安装Git:在您的电脑上安装Git工具,您可以从Git官网下载并安装。
- 注册GitHub账户:如果还没有GitHub账户,请访问GitHub官网注册一个。
- 选择要复制的项目:浏览GitHub,找到您想要复制的项目。
2. 获取项目的克隆地址
在将项目复制到本地之前,您需要获取项目的克隆地址。具体步骤如下:
-
打开您想要复制的GitHub项目页面。
-
点击页面右上角的“Code”按钮。
-
复制HTTPS或SSH链接(建议使用HTTPS链接,如果您不熟悉SSH设置)。
3. 在本地复制GitHub项目
获取到克隆地址后,您可以使用以下命令在本地复制GitHub项目:
3.1 使用命令行克隆项目
-
打开终端(在Windows上为命令提示符或PowerShell)。
-
输入以下命令:
bash
git clone [项目克隆地址]例如:
bash
git clone https://github.com/username/repository.git -
按下Enter键,系统将自动将项目复制到您的本地计算机。
3.2 使用Git GUI工具克隆项目
如果您不熟悉命令行,可以使用Git GUI工具进行克隆,步骤如下:
- 打开您所使用的Git GUI工具。
- 选择“克隆”或“获取项目”选项。
- 粘贴项目的克隆地址并选择目标文件夹。
- 点击“克隆”按钮,等待下载完成。
4. 验证项目克隆成功
克隆完成后,您可以通过以下步骤验证项目是否成功复制:
-
进入您选择的目标文件夹。
-
查看文件夹中是否有项目文件。
-
打开终端并运行以下命令:
bash
cd [项目文件夹]
git status如果显示项目状态,说明克隆成功。
5. 注意事项
在将GitHub项目复制到本地时,您需要注意以下几点:
- 网络连接:确保您的网络连接稳定,以避免克隆过程中出现中断。
- 权限问题:对于某些私有项目,您需要相应的权限才能克隆。
- 文件大小:某些项目可能包含大量文件,克隆时可能需要一些时间。
6. 常见问题解答
Q1: 如何克隆私有GitHub项目?
A: 若要克隆私有项目,您需要拥有相应的访问权限,并且可能需要配置SSH密钥或使用带有用户名和密码的HTTPS链接。
Q2: 克隆的项目能否在本地修改?
A: 可以。在克隆后,您可以在本地修改代码,但请注意不要推送到原始仓库,除非您有权限。
Q3: 如果我只想复制特定文件或文件夹,应该怎么做?
A: Git本身不支持直接克隆部分文件,但您可以手动下载特定文件或使用git sparse-checkout
命令来选择性地克隆。
Q4: 如何更新本地项目以获取远程仓库的最新更改?
A: 您可以使用git pull
命令来更新本地项目:
bash
git pull origin main
请根据您的主分支名称(如main
或master
)进行调整。
7. 总结
将GitHub项目复制到本地是进行开发的基础步骤。通过本文的详细介绍,您可以轻松完成这一过程。在开发过程中,确保时常更新您的本地项目,并积极参与社区贡献,共同推动开源项目的发展。希望这篇文章能帮助您更好地理解和使用GitHub!